Shrapnel is embedded in his chest. It’s close to his heart. Too close for comfort, and definitely too close for surgery at a field hospital. So, Tony does what Tony does. He builds a solution.
The personal arc reactor isn’t just a power source. It’s a life support system.
Specifically, it powers an electromagnet. This magnet sits right behind his sternum. It pushes the metal fragments away from his heart. If the power dies, the magnet fails. If the magnet fails, the shrapnel moves. If the shrapnel moves, the heart stops.
It’s a simple loop. A vicious loop.
He built a suit to keep the world at bay. He built a reactor to keep himself alive.
We’ve seen the miniaturization. We’ve seen the sleek, white glowing discs in Iron Man 3. We’ve seen the massive, dirty, jury-rigged version in the first film. But the function never changes. It’s an electromagnet. It keeps the shards of enemy weapons from puncturing his aorta.
Why does this matter? Because it ties Tony’s survival directly to his technology. He isn’t just Iron Man because of the suit. He’s Iron Man because he couldn’t live any other way.
